George Lindbeck (1923–2018) was one of the most influential and important of postwar American theologians. His books and essays have generated debate not only among his fellow Lutherans but also among other Christians, as well as Jewish thinkers and students of religions in the academy more generally. The goal of this anthology is to collect key samples of his enterprise.
